Is 100 717 012 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 100 717 012 is about 10 035.787.

Thus, the square root of 100 717 012 is not an integer, and therefore 100 717 012 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 100 717 012?

The square of a number (here 100 717 012) is the result of the product of this number (100 717 012) by itself (i.e., 100 717 012 × 100 717 012); the square of 100 717 012 is sometimes called "raising 100 717 012 to the power 2", or "100 717 012 squared".

The square of 100 717 012 is 10 143 916 506 208 144 because 100 717 012 × 100 717 012 = 100 717 0122 = 10 143 916 506 208 144.

As a consequence, 100 717 012 is the square root of 10 143 916 506 208 144.
